Drain cleaning is crucial for keeping plumbing systems efficient and odor-free. Whether in kitchens, bathrooms, or utility spaces, maintaining clean drains can help avoid backups and long-term damage.
Importance of Routine Drain Cleaning
Over time, drains collect hair, soap residue, grease, food particles, and mineral deposits. Without regular maintenance, this buildup can lead to unpleasant odors, slow drainage, or full blockages. Professional drain cleaning services use safe, effective methods to clear debris and restore optimal water flow.Depending on the issue, tools such as drain snakes, hydro-jetting, or enzymatic cleaners may be used. These methods can address issues deep within the plumbing without damaging the pipes. Regular cleanings also serve as preventive maintenance, helping to identify early warning signs before major problems occur.
